Output 59072645a92e38727ed70151f600a52876bc2a117db36bad3a584737e64775f6:7

value
5692866
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c8a9cf3fc99953480bf12fefad35c1806073ee0 OP_EQUALVERIFY OP_CHECKSIG
address
1CMWqo3Ybi1149yLqXxmoPWrhdVytKhBWb
transaction
59072645a92e38727ed70151f600a52876bc2a117db36bad3a584737e64775f6
spent
true